    Science & PublishingThe push-and-pull evolution of tandem-duplicated drug-resistance genesTwo highly similar genes that contribute to drug resistance in a pathogenic yeast have been co-evolving as tandem duplicates for the past 134 million years—while maintaining distinct functions. This is the conclusion of a paper in the April issue of GENETICS by Lamping et al. that examines the evolutionary effects of ectopic gene conversion. Evolutionary…

    Science & PublishingCause of fatal naked foal syndrome revealedWhen a horse is born with naked foal syndrome (NFS), it will likely die early. This genetic skin condition affects the Akhal-Teke horse breed from Turkmenistan, which is known for its speed, endurance, and intelligence. Worryingly, the incidence of NFS seems to be increasing.     Science & PublishingLive long and prosper (under the right conditions)Restricting calorie intake seems to promote longer lives in a wide range of organisms, from microbes to mammals. Some determined youth-seekers are already adopting reduced-calorie diets in an attempt to extend their lifespans.     Science & PublishingIncompatibility between mitochondrial and nuclear genomes isolates many nematode populationsConstant mutation and shaping by natural selection can make the once-identical genomes of isolated populations of organisms very different from one another. This genetic divergence can lead to two such populations no longer being able to interbreed successfully—speciation.
